Japan Camel Duvets Market: Supply Chain and Value Chain Analysis
The supply chain for camel duvets in Japan is highly specialized, involving sourcing, processing, manufacturing, and distribution. Raw camel wool is primarily imported from Mongolia, Africa, and Central Asia, with quality standards tightly regulated to meet Japan’s high consumer expectations. Processing involves cleaning, carding, and blending with other natural fibers to enhance performance attributes such as thermal insulation and hypoallergenic properties.
The value chain emphasizes sustainable sourcing and ethical practices, which are increasingly important to Japanese consumers. Manufacturers focus on integrating eco-friendly processing techniques and transparent supply chain management to boost brand credibility. Distribution channels include luxury department stores, boutique bedding outlets, and direct online platforms. The entire value chain is under pressure to innovate in logistics, reduce carbon footprint, and ensure traceability, aligning with Japan’s environmental commitments and consumer values.
